PSU, Public Participation in Three TPS Reaches 70 Percent

Klojen (malangkota.go.id) – The level of public participation in the implementation of the Re-vote (PSU) at three TPS in Malang City, Thursday (25/4/2019) reached 70 percent and the implementation went smoothly and conducively. Although the level of public participation was not as high as in the Simultaneous Election on April 17, 2019, which was around 80 percent, 70 percent was the maximum, considering that the voting day was an active working day.

Re-voting Process

The polling stations that held the PSU were TPS 14, Penanggunan Village, TPS 17, Sukoharjo Village, Klojen District, and TPS 9, Bunulrejo Village, Blimbing District.

Before the PSU was implemented, the Malang City KPU made various efforts, such as socialization to residents, business owners and agencies around the TPS so that workers or employees who worked were compensated. As a result, the level of community participation reached 70 percent in the three TPS that held the PSU.

That was what was conveyed by the Commissioner of the Malang City KPU, Aminah Asminingtyas, Thursday (25/04/2019), after monitoring the implementation of the PSU. For the KPUD, although the participation rate was not as high as the Election on April 17 which reached 80 percent, the figure of 70 percent was considered high. "The implementation of the PSU is not a holiday, where most residents carry out their routines. However, the enthusiasm of the residents is extraordinary," he said.

In this PSU, Aminah said that KPPS officers together with election organizers also visited a number of residents who were sick and could not cast their votes at the TPS. "The next stage, the Malang City KPUD will continue the vote counting at the sub-district level (PPK) and is targeted to be completed by the end of April," added the woman in the hijab.

He added that the PSU this time was welcomed enthusiastically and residents did not feel burdened when they had to come to the TPS for the second time.
